Defense carries Texans past Steelers, into divisional round
The Texans' defense came into the postseason viewed as one of the league's best and showed why in their 30-6 wild-card win over Aaron Rodgers and the Steelers on Monday night.

Rodgers, Heyward back Tomlin, as Texans end Steelers' season
On Monday, as the Pittsburgh Steelers dropped a fifth straight playoff game by double digits, coach Mike Tomlin endured angry "Fire Tomlin" chants from fans during his club's 30-6 loss to the Houston Texans, the franchise's seventh straight playoff loss.
